The input fileupload object represents an html input element with type file. Webview input typefile not working xamarin community forums. The file state represents a list of selected files, each file consisting of a file name, a file type, and a file body the contents of the file. Attach only pdf or zip files salesforce developer community. Form, and the input type file acceptimage works perfectly it will open up a dialog with various options.
If you want visitors to submit information say a picture, a spreadsheet, a wordprocessed document or a scanned document, they can use this field to simply upload the file with the hassle of using ftp or email the file. Form, and the input typefile acceptimage works perfectly it will open up a dialog with various options. Jsfiddle or its authors are not responsible or liable for any loss or damage of any kind during the usage of provided code. This is actually a very subtle change thats very useful as it makes it much easier to send multiple files to the server without using complex uploader controls. Html how do you select folder with file input free html tutorials, help, tips, tricks, and more. However, there are many additional types you can use to accept form data that doesnt fit into any of the types listed above. Restricting user to upload a csv file solved servlets. You can create an element with typefile by using the document. Password input controls this is also a singleline text input but it masks the character as soon as a user enters it.
Bug tracker roadmap vote for features about docs service status. You could do so by using the attribute accept and adding allowed mimetypes to it. It is a hint to browsers to only show files that are allowed for the current input. Url is not shown in the microsoft edge web browser. This displays a browse button, which the user can click on to select a file on their local computer. The accept attribute gets a commaseparated list of mime types for files desired file types. Now i would like to restrict this by accepting only. Input type file with accept attribute jsfiddle code. This adds usage complexity, since authors need to take care to create new unique ids for each instance. Html also supports a special input field, a file field, to allow visitors to upload files. I tried many ways of making the file explorer open. There is an accept attribute on file input controls, where you can specify the types of files you want. By asking for you are asking for a file with the extention of csv with no file name.
The accept attribute value is a string that defines the file types the file input should accept. How to make a file field that only accept pdf and doc. Oct 03, 2003 user agents may use this information to filter out nonconforming files when prompting a user to select files to be sent to the server cf. I need to accept only pdf and doc file using input type file. You can access an input element with type file by using getelementbyid. How to make input type file should accept only pdf and. The accept attribute specifies a filter for what file types the user can pick from the file input dialog box only for typefile. You can also access input type file by searching through the elements collection of a form. Webview input typefile not working xamarin community. To restrict the types of files a user can select using, i set the following property.
Home html how to make input type file should accept only pdf and xls how to make input type file should accept only pdf and xls posted by. See, if the clientos dont know about what is the mimetype of. My fillable form pdf is not allowing user input into the. Once a file has been selected, the file name appears next to the button. And when i click the files pdfxls on webpage it should automatically open. Nov 24, 2017 there is an accept attribute on file input controls, where you can specify the types of files you want. In this case, twitter is allowing the user to upload common image formats. Because of this, you should make sure that the accept attribute is backed up by appropriate serverside validation. They are also created using html tag but type attribute is set to password. Because a given file type may be identified in more than one manner, its useful to provide a thorough set of type specifiers when you need files of a given format. The input fileupload object represents an html element with typefile.
If you search for a solution to the common problem of how to get full appearance control over an, the result will probably fit into one of 3 categories. How to only accept images in an input file field when adding a file field to a form, you might want to limit the selector to images. They are also created using html input tag but type attribute is set to password. Using the accept attribute, i found these contenttypes took. Accept parameter filtering on file dialog select in html usually we used relay on flash for file upload, where has we can use the html5 for that example i want to select only docpdfimage file for uploading it was really a painful job in javascript. This should, supposedly, only list images in the file browser box when you click browse. In this case you can check for the file extension once the user uploads the file and validate the same using the java file api you can also add a file type to the dialog box that opens up when you click to upload a file, i. I have my page for upload files but i want to restrict the file type only for pdf or zip i have in code.
You can also access by searching through the elements collection of a form. Jun 02, 2015 the accept attribute gets a commaseparated list of mime types for files desired file types. Filepicker window infinitely reopens after opening. Html forms allow users to input data that is submitted to a web server many types of controls are possible other options file selection for upload tabbing navigation tabindex attribute access keys accesskey attribute disabled and readonly controls for more information and options, see. Total inputtypefile style control with pure css example. Apr 19, 2017 here mudassar ahmed khan has explained with an example, how to create html fileupload element file using html helper and model in asp.
When present, it specifies that the user is allowed to enter more than one value in the input element. Hi, i am trying to use the accept file input for limit the file type that a user can choose when uploading a file. Type of value of html accept attribute is a valid content typefor example imagegif. It does know it is being clicked on, but the event which opens up the file explorer wont open. There is no default value of html accept attribute. To restrict the types of files a user can select using input typefile, i set the following property. Here mudassar ahmed khan has explained with an example, how to create html fileupload element file using html helper and model in asp. It requires a single wrapping element to hook the styles onto the. Textboxfor function is used and the type attribute is set to value. First one will be all 3 of them all pngs, pdfs and txts will be listed at the same time and this filter is the default one.
When i click the submit button it should validate this. The accept attribute specifies the types of files that the server accepts that can be submitted through a file upload. You can use the accept keyword of the input tag of html. Stack overflow for teams is a private, secure spot for you and your coworkers to find and share information. This string is a commaseparated list of unique file type specifiers. Mabye they mean they made is so user agents could do that but none actually do, heh. You can create an input element with type file by using the document. User agents may use this information to filter out nonconforming files when prompting a user to select files to be sent to the server cf. Per html5 spec the input type file tag allows for multiple files to be picked from a single file upload button. A content type or a commaseparated list of content types. All code belongs to the poster and no license is enforced. How to make input type file should accept only pdf and xls.
That bill certainly fit every single answer i found on stackoverflow. The accept attribute specifies a filter for what file types the user can pick from the file input dialog box only for type file. The accept attribute can only be used with input type file. You can access an element with typefile by using getelementbyid. The multiple attribute works with the following input types. My fillable form pdf is not allowing user input into the fields. Firefox currently only supports multiple for input typefile. From what im seeing, though, many browsers like to ignore it the file types that can be specified are mime types, so a strictly correct browser would have to look at every file regardless of extension and see if its an image and if so, what type it is. C computers cli css database devtools electronics express git go graphql html javascript lab network next. In a form, the file value of the type attribute allows you to define an input element for file uploads.
By default, there is no html helper method for creating html fileupload element in asp. Jul 25, 2019 if you search for a solution to the common problem of how to get full appearance control over an input type file, the result will probably fit into one of 3 categories. If you are wanting a selected list of files in an input window, try. When present, it specifies that the user is allowed to enter more than one value in the element. It is still possible in most cases for users to toggle an option in the file chooser that makes it possible to override this and select any file they wish, and then choose incorrect file types. Many forms make use of just one or two input types, and most simple forms are built using just the types listed above. A string that defines the file types the file input should accept.